Abstract
Computer aided optimization of radiation characteristics of wire antennas by a step by step variation of the geometry has been proposed in the past by several authors. The simple structure of most of the present microstrip antennas suggests looking for improved radiation characteristics by more complicated contours and to do this by a synthesis process. An essential element of such a process is a method for the analysis. This analysis has to be sufficiently precise in the description of the reality. On the other hand the required computing time should be moderate. To meet both of these requirements simultaneously, the methods of Okoshi (1985) and Gupta et al. (1981) have been combined to a new analysis procedure as the basis of the optimization approach
